# Turnstile counter client setup.
#
# This client talks to the Gatewarden ingest API, which aggregates
# entry counts from every turnstile at Bramblefield Stadium. Counts
# are batched every five seconds; do not lower the interval or the
# ingest tier will throttle us. Retries are handled internally with
# jittered backoff, so never wrap calls in your own retry loop.
# Authenticate with the internal service key provided here:

API key for hafop-bajog: qvz15-rtly2XOSD9Zm19U

Welcome, plugin authors. Fernwood components are verified with snapshot tests: each render is serialized and compared against a stored baseline, so any visual change must be deliberately approved. Please run the snapshot suite before submitting. Baselines are fetched from our internal Mirrorbank service, which requires authentication. Use the following key for read-only access.

app token of bahaf-tajeg = zpat23_SjjsllwiLmXbtS65veZaV47

## Service Accounts — ShoalClock Tide Widget

The ShoalClock widget fetches tide tables from our internal HarborFeed service using a dedicated service account, scoped read-only to the tides dataset. The account cannot write, list other datasets, or mint tokens. Rotation occurs quarterly via the Kelpworks scheduler. For audit purposes, the currently active key is recorded here.

app token of tageg-tajeg = vxb2-a5